In this life of ours, you just never know when your last breath might occur. That’s the life philosophy that Vladimir Kazbekov lives by. The talented up-and-coming amateur fighter will step back into the cage this weekend when he meets undefeated Jonas Rubiano.

My thoughts about Jonas that he is a good fighter,” says the Team Ascension fighter. “In general I respect him already because he accepted the fight and never turned it down.” The reason he made the point was he had his fair ordeal of fighters that have backed out of fights in the past. Now as we are days away from Gladiators of the Cage: The North Shore’s Rise to Power VI, the Canadian is certain Jonas will show up on Saturday.

Earlier this year Kazbekov suffered his first loss. “I am a different fighter now, way better [than I was],” when asked what, if anything, has changed since then. He went back to the drawing board and with the help of his coaches who he gives high praises he told us, “I’ve learned a lot after that loss so I’m glad it happened.”

That was evident when he met Sean Highfill this past June. Heading into that fight, he told us that he wanted to showcase some of his newly crafted skills. However, he was not able to as he finished the then undefeated Highfill in just :29 seconds. This time around he plans to put his skills on display, if given the opportunity.

When asked if the fight this weekend goes his way what does the future hold. He responded very elegantly with, “You never know what can happen to you in next 5 minutes. [You] can go to sleep and not wake up.” With that type of mentality, you can believe that he plans to give it his all every time he steps inside the cage. Of course, the Russian native also was more realistic when he said, “all I care about is this fight [right] now.”
